Understanding 4K Resolution

4K resolution, also known as Ultra High Definition (UHD), refers to a screen resolution of 3840 x 2160 pixels. This resolution provides four times the pixel count of a traditional 1080p display, resulting in sharper images, finer details, and a more immersive viewing experience.
